zoukankan      html  css  js  c++  java
  • MySQL

    1、安装
    Mac 启动: 系统偏好设置——>MySQL——> Start MySQL Server
    如无法检测mysql,请添加环境变量。参考:https://www.cnblogs.com/developer-qin/p/14505271.html
    export PATH=$PATH:/usr/local/mysql/bin
    2、验证安装
    mysqladmin --version

    3、启动
    mysql -h 主机名 -u 用户名 -p  
    mysql -u root -p   #启动
    
    mysql> SHOW VARIABLES WHERE Variable_name = 'port';  #显示port
    mysql> SHOW VARIABLES WHERE Variable_name = 'hostname';
    
    mysql>select user();
    4、
    CREATE DATABASE 数据库名;
    drop database <数据库名>;

    SHOW DATABASES;
    use mysql; // 切换数据库

    show tables;

    update `deployments` set `deployment_key`='xxx' where `id`=5
    -------------------------------------------------------------
    报错1:
    Client does not support authentication protocol requested by server; consider upgrading MySQL client
    原因: MySQL8.0版本的加密方式和MySQL5.0的不一样,连接会报错。
    解决方法: 如下:启动mysql之后,操作。
      1. 更改加密方式(原样拷贝到命令窗中) 
        m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EXPIRE NEVER;
      2. 更改密码:该例子中 123456为新密码 
        mysql> 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
      3. 刷新: 
        mysql> FLUSH PRIVILEGES;


     
     
  • 相关阅读:
    hdu1313 Round and Round We Go (大数乘法)
    select样式控制
    tp5 分页后追加数据方法
    tp5请求类型
    layui 参数祥解
    jquery 阻止label冒泡
    svn的配置
    destoon 根目录文件结构
    关于jquery中on绑定click事件在苹果手机失效的问题
    正则表达式中的match,test,exec,search的返回值
  • 原文地址:https://www.cnblogs.com/developer-qin/p/14582709.html
Copyright © 2011-2022 走看看